VIBRANT MATCHA AND MINT FOCUS ENERGISING TEA
Vibrant Matcha And Mint Focus Energising Tea is a vibrant and energising beverage that combines the rich and earthy flavour of matcha with the bright and cooling freshness of mint leaves. This invigorating blend is packed with antioxidants and provides a gentle caffeine lift, making it ideal for morning rituals or mid-day refreshments. Matcha is a finely ground powder of specially grown green tea and is renowned for its concentration of catechins, chlorophyll and L-theanine, which is a compound known to support calm focus. When paired with fresh mint, which aids digestion and soothes the senses, the result is a refreshing tea that awakens both body and mind. This simple recipe is low in calories, quick to prepare and suited to those seeking a plant-based, low-sugar beverage with health-promoting benefits. Whether sipped warm or served over ice, Vibrant Matcha And Mint Focus Energising Tea are a modern and healthy essential.

INGREDIENTS
Here is a list of ingredients for the preparation of Vibrant Matcha And Mint Focus Energising Tea:
- 0.50 grams | 0.02 ounces | ¼ teaspoon matcha powder
- 0.20 grams | 0.01 ounces | 2 mint leaves
- 200 milliliters | 6.76 fluid ounces | hot water

PREPARATION
These steps are followed for the preparation of Vibrant Matcha And Mint Focus Energising Tea:
- Heat Water: Bring 200 millilitres of water to a gentle boil, then allow it to cool slightly to 75 to 80 degrees Celsius to avoid burning the matcha.
- Prepare Matcha: Sift the matcha powder into a cup or small bowl to prevent clumping.
- Whisk: Add a small amount of hot water to the matcha and whisk vigorously using a bamboo whisk or fork until the mixture is frothy and smooth.
- Add Mint: Lightly bruise the mint leaves to release their oils, then add them to the cup.
- Pour And Stir: Pour in the remaining hot water and stir gently to blend the flavours.
- Serve Immediately: Enjoy warm or let it cool and serve over ice for a chilled version.

TIPS
Here are some helpful tips for Vibrant Matcha And Mint Focus Energising Tea:
- Use Cooler Water: Avoid boiling water directly on matcha to maintain its delicate flavour and nutrient content.
- Sift The Matcha: This helps dissolve the powder evenly and prevents lumps from forming.
- Whisk In A W Motion: This technique creates a frothy top layer and better integration.
- Use Fresh Mint: Always use fresh and bright-green mint leaves for the best aroma and taste.
VARIATIONS
- Citrus Zest Twist: Add a thin slice of lemon or orange peel to enhance brightness.
- Mint-Matcha Iced Latte: Mix in chilled plant-based milk and a dash of vanilla.
- Sweetened Option: Add a teaspoon of maple syrup or honey for a lightly sweetened finish.
- Spiced Version: A pinch of cinnamon or cardamom introduces warm and earthy notes.
PREPPING AND STORAGE
- Refrigeration: Store brewed tea in a sealed glass jar or bottle for up to 24 hours.
- Chilled Matcha: Brew ahead and store in the refrigerator for a quick and cool pick-me-up.
- Freeze Into Cubes: Pour into an ice cube tray and freeze for mint-matcha ice cubes, perfect for flavoured water or smoothies.
- Batch Preparation: Triple the quantity and blend for use throughout the day, especially in summer.
